DEF: Otter Tail Corporation Reports Record Earnings in 2024, Announces Dividend Increase
Proxy Statement
Otter Tail Corporation achieved record earnings in 2024 with diluted earnings per share of $7.17 and increased its dividend by 12% in February 2025.
Summary
- Otter Tail Corporation had record earnings in 2024, with diluted earnings per share reaching $7.17.
- The company achieved a return on equity of 19% on an equity layer of 62%.
- Otter Tail Corporation has paid dividends to shareholders for 86 consecutive years.
- In February 2025, the company increased its dividend by 12%, resulting in an annual indicated dividend of $2.10.
- Otter Tail Power Company received regulatory approval for its Integrated Resource Plan and a general rate case.
- The company's manufacturing platform faced changing market conditions in 2024.
- Plastic pipe businesses had strong financial results due to customer sales volume growth and improved end market demand.
- The first phase of Vinyltech Corporation's expansion project was completed, adding large diameter PVC pipe production capability.
- An expansion project at BTD Georgia is expected to be completed in early 2025.
- The company's diversified business model allows its manufacturing platform to fund electric utility rate base growth without needing to raise equity.

Future Outlook
The company aims to continue producing value for employees, customers, and shareholders, with a long-term earnings per share growth rate of 6-8% and a 5-year capital spending plan of $1.6 billion.
